在JS中如何巧妙运用三个点改变你的代码🚀

在JS中如何巧妙运用三个点改变你的代码🚀

JavaScript 中的三点运算符(...)是一种强大的工具,可以用于多种场景,包括但不限于数组和对象的解构、函数参数的处理等。本文将详细介绍三点运算符的基本概念及其在实际开发中的应用。

基本概念

三点运算符有两种主要用途:作为扩展运算符和作为剩余参数。当用作扩展运算符时,它可以将一个数组或对象展开成多个元素或属性;而作为剩余参数时,则可以收集函数调用时传递的多个参数,并将其打包成一个数组。

应用场景

  • 数组操作: 如合并两个数组、复制数组等。
  • 对象操作: 如合并对象、浅拷贝对象等。
  • 函数参数: 简化函数参数列表,实现变长参数函数。

开发者社区中的讨论热度

此话题在开发者社区引起了广泛关注,主要是因为三点运算符极大地简化了某些常见的编程任务,提高了代码的可读性和效率。许多开发者分享了自己的使用经验和技巧,促进了这一特性的普及。

技术趋势与行业动态

随着JavaScript语言的不断进化,越来越多的新特性被引入以满足日益复杂的开发需求。三点运算符正是这种趋势的一个体现,它反映了现代编程语言设计中对于简洁性和表达力的追求。此外,这也表明了开发者社区对于提高生产力和代码质量的持续关注。

主要观点与反馈

大多数开发者认为三点运算符是JavaScript的一个重要改进,它不仅简化了代码,还增强了语言的功能。然而,也有部分开发者提醒,在使用三点运算符时需要注意性能问题,尤其是在处理大量数据时。总体而言,社区对此持积极态度。

对技术发展的影响

三点运算符的应用有助于推动JavaScript编程的最佳实践,鼓励开发者采用更现代、更高效的方法来编写代码。长远来看,这将促进整个前端开发领域的技术进步,使Web应用程序更加健壮、灵活。